
Bodi FIN – a financial literacy project for primary school children
Under the patronage of Acting Governor Primož Dolenc and Minister of Finance Klemen Boštjančič, Banka Slovenije and the Ministry of Finance are once again organising the Bodi FIN financial literacy project, this time for the 2025/2026 school year.
The project is aimed at students from fourth to ninth grades of primary school, who will participate in a variety of activities to help them think about financial subjects related to digital security. They will learn the basics of managing their own finances, and will discover how to recognise online fraud and how to use online payment systems safely. They will also learn about the importance of protecting personal data, how to create secure passwords, and how to act responsibly with AI.
The course of the project
Mentors will receive the Bodi FIN workbook, which they will tackle together with their students in class. The mentors will be able to submit the completed workbooks to Banka Slovenije, with the students receiving a symbolic prize in return.
The project officially begins on 7 November 2025 with an open doors day, at which visitors will be able to learn about a variety of financial content in a fun way through an interactive educational programme.
Banka Slovenije will also hold a seminar for project mentors on 28 November 2025. A number of finance workshops will be held at primary schools over the course of the school year.
The project will conclude in March 2026 with online competition, which will relate directly to the content of the Bodi FIN workbooks.
We will draw 25 students from among the recipients of the gold award, who will go on a two-day trip to Zagreb and visit the Croatian National Bank. The other gold award recipients will receive practical prizes.
